Output 84ca931c6811e53fc8e59e992229a35cbf95be6c028f194bd3226055ed9584a9:20

value
43123140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a107abe65e0e1e964e8da307c75323a2cb15f883 OP_EQUAL
address
MNacDLcQxHcyEtwi144auH465gYDK3ZuRZ
transaction
84ca931c6811e53fc8e59e992229a35cbf95be6c028f194bd3226055ed9584a9
spent
true